Humanitarian fears mount as airport is last obstacle before city of Bukavu and its population of about 1m people
Rebels from the Rwandan-backed M23 group have seized the strategically important airport serving Bukavu, the capital of South Kivu province in the Democratic Republic of the Congo, following a rapid advance south in recent days.
